Must the county maintain a road leading to a cemetery if the road is not in the county road system? The county is prohibited from abandoning a county road leading to a cemetery. 11. However, a county’s decision as to the frequency of maintenance of any particular county road is a matter for the discretion of the commissioners court. 12. 10.

WebObject Moved This document may be found here WebIn FY2024, Galveston County had $2,950,054 in indigent defense expenditures. The county was awarded $234,623 in formula grant funding from TIDC in FY2024. Since FY2016, indigent defense spending has increased.
